In the ever-evolving landscape of the Chinese automotive industry, a critical debate has emerged around the growing trend of new energy vehicles (NEVs) becoming increasingly larger and heavier. The secretary general of the China Passenger Car Association (CPCA), Cui Dongshu, has recently weighed in on this issue, advocating for a reevaluation of China's tax and energy-consumption management measures to curb this trend. His concerns are not merely about resource wastage but also about the broader implications for road infrastructure and vehicle development.
One of the key points Cui emphasizes is the historical context of combustion-engine automakers' caution in developing large SUVs. These automakers were constrained by displacement-based taxes, which incentivized them to produce more compact models. However, with the advent of NEVs, this tax structure has become obsolete. Cui argues that the current tax system fails to curb the trend towards larger vehicles and excessive power, leading to a waste of resources and an increase in road wear and tear.
In my opinion, Cui's concerns are particularly relevant in the context of China's rapidly growing NEV market. The data released by the CPCA on Wednesday shows that NEV retail penetration rate reached 62.8% in June, up 9.5 percentage points year on year. This indicates a significant shift towards NEVs, and with it, a growing demand for larger and heavier models. The trend towards longer driving ranges, often achieved through larger battery packs, is not only driving up the weight of vehicles but also increasing the strain on road infrastructure.
